Photos: Dutch sink in Quarterfinals

Last Thursday, the Guilderland Dutchmen girls' basketball opened up in the quarterfinals in the class AA sectional playoffs at Shenendehowa High School against Colonie. The Dutch fell 59-to-53.

Formidable foe: Guilderland’s Valencia Fontenelle-Posson defends Colonie’s Ahnalese Pearson in the first half. She had 14 points in the game and made history late in the fourth quarter when she became the second Guilderland girl to score 1,000 points for the Dutch — and she’s a sophomore.

Going strong: Guilderland’s Jamie Golderman goes for a layup in the fourth quarter as Colonie’s Alivia Paeglow watches. Golderman had one point in the Dutch’s 59-to-53 loss in the Class AA sectional quarterfinals at Shenendehowa High School last Thursday evening.

Easy points: Guilderland’s Gracianna Serravillo, right, goes for a layup after stealing the ball away from Colonie’s Ahnalese Pearson in the first quarter. Serravillo led the Dutch with 16 points.
